== Software ==
This system uses the [[:fedora:Koji|Koji]] build software, which is a client-server hub-builder system. Jobs are queued by client systems (whether manually, by package maintainers, or automatically, by a script) to the hub; the builders pick up jobs from the hub and execute them, building software packages and performing related maintenance (such as repository updates). Package builds are performed with [[:fedora:Projects/Mock|Mock]] using an isolated, chroot build environment created specifically for the package being built.
== Access ==
This Koji system uses Fedora [https://admin.fedoraproject.org/accounts/ FAS2] certificates, so any person with access to the Fedora [http://koji.fedoraproject.org primary architecture Koji system] has access to the [http://arm.koji.fedoraproject.org Fedora-ARM Koji system] as well.
A web interface is provided for viewing the system status, accessing built packages, and controlling tasks at http://arm.koji.fedoraproject.org
